Shea Butter: A Healing and Nourishing Agent

Shea butter is renowned for its skin-loving properties. It is a rich, emollient fat extracted from the nuts of the African shea tree. This natural ingredient offers deep moisturization. It penetrates the skin effectively. Shea butter contains vitamins A, E, and F. These vitamins are vital for skin health. They promote healthy cell growth. These also protect against environmental damage. Furthermore, shea butter boasts impressive anti-inflammatory properties. This helps to reduce swelling and redness during healing. It also soothes irritated skin. Its natural composition supports the skin’s barrier function. This keeps your tattoo protected and vibrant.

Mango Butter: Antibacterial and Antimicrobial Protection

Mango butter is another star ingredient in Hustle Butter. It is extracted from the seeds of mango fruit. This butter is light yet incredibly nourishing. It is packed with antioxidants and vitamins. These nutrients aid in skin repair. They help fight off free radicals. Crucially, mango butter possesses natural antibacterial properties. It also has antimicrobial qualities. These characteristics are vital for tattoo aftercare. They help guard against potential infections. Infection is a serious risk during healing. Mango butter creates a healthier skin environment. It keeps harmful pathogens at bay. This dual action supports safe and effective healing. It helps your tattoo maintain its integrity.
